[0001] This application relates to the field of textile technology, and in particular to a rope end plugging and tasseling device and equipment. Background Technology
[0002] In the manufacturing process of trousers, one method involves inserting the rope end inside the fabric and then bar-tapping it. This process requires inserting the rope end a certain distance inside the fabric before bar-tapping. Traditionally, this process is done manually, with employees using tweezers to insert one end of the rope into the fabric before moving it to the next step for bar-tapping. However, manual operation can lead to inconsistent product quality and low production efficiency. Utility Model Content

[0030] The aforementioned rope end plugging and tacking device can automatically perform rope end plugging and tacking operations. In use, the worker places the rope material on the working surface of the work platform, with the rope end to be plugged protruding from the platform at the first through groove. The rope material is held by the first and second clamping members on the upper and lower sides of the first through groove in the vertical direction, respectively, separating its bottom surface to expose the plugging opening. Then, the rope end is inserted into the plugging opening by a movable third clamping member. After the third clamping member retracts, the rope end is plugged to the required depth by moving a moving rod along the first direction at the plugging opening. After plugging, the rope material can be transferred from the working surface to the tacking station by a feeding mechanism for subsequent tacking processing. The rope end plugging and tacking device of this application can automatically perform rope end plugging and tacking operations, improving product quality stability and production efficiency. [0055] In use, the sixth moving member 403 is moved along the second direction by the sixth driving member 402, so that the third clamping member 408 is aligned with the rope end of the first through slot 209. Then, the seventh moving member 405 is moved along the first direction by the seventh driving member 404, so that the third clamping member 408 is close to the rope end. The third moving member is then clamped by the eighth driving member 406, and the third clamping member 408 is moved to insert the rope end into the inner plug. After the third clamping member 408 is pushed out, the moving rod 410 is adjusted to be aligned with the inner plug. Then, the moving rod 410 is moved along the first direction by the ninth driving member 409, so that the rope end can be inserted to the required depth.

[0060] After the rope end is plugged, the rope material can be transferred from the working surface to the tack-making station for tack-making via the feeding mechanism 500. The pressing component 507 can press the rope end firmly and move it to the tack-making station to prevent the plugged rope end from leaking out.
[0061] Reference Figure 7As shown, in some embodiments, the rope end plugging and tacking device 1 further includes a rope end anti-deflection correction mechanism 600. The rope end anti-deflection correction mechanism 600 includes a limiting member 601, a lifting member 602, a tacking pressing plate 603, a second through groove 604, and a blowing member 605. The lifting member 602 and the blowing member 605 are mounted on the fixed frame 100. The lifting member 602 is capable of vertical movement, and the side of the lifting member 602 facing the operating table has a tacking pressing plate 603, which is used to press materials. The tacking pressing plate 603 has a second through groove 604 that penetrates the tacking pressing plate 603 vertically. The limiting member 601 is mounted on the operating table. The blowing member 605 has an air outlet, which is positioned facing the limiting member 601.
[0062] After the rope end is delivered to the tacking station, it is placed against the limiting part 601. If the rope end is crooked, it can be adjusted by blowing air into the rope end through the air outlet. Then, it is tacking processed in the second through groove 604 of the tacking pressing plate 603.
